Yesterday I brought my URSA mini pro 4.6K - firmware 4.5 - on a production for the first time for recording an interview.

First thing, I plugged the camera to the mains and recorded to the SD card, using a radio mic. There was a popping sound going very low all the time.

So I used a Vlock battery. The popping sound was gone but a very low kind of clicking - think like a metronome - was going on this time.

Then I finally used my SSD recorder instead of the SD cards and all the noises where gone...

I used my radio mic for many productions in any cameras and never had an issue.
Sennheiser EW 112-P G3
Angelbird AB-AVP128SD AV Pro 128GB SDXC UHS-II Class 10 V90 SD Card

I'd love to use my camera on mains and record my interviews on SD cards so it's easier to pass them to a client.

This is what I got back from BM support:

"From listening to the audio, I can confirm that this is behaviour which is known about on the Ursa Mini Pro cameras and has been escalated to the development team. We don't have a timescale on when this will be addressed as this is not information that we receive however if we do hear anything I will let you know.

In the meantime you will find that this behaviour can be alleviated by using a -20dB pad or by using a line in input."

The beeping is gone, but using the pad do increase the hiss...
I just further tested and I'm going to send my files to a sound recordist friend of mine and see what his comments are and let you know here.

Recording on SSD seems to be the work around for the moment.
